Sisällysluettelo:
- Vaihe 1: Käytetty ohjelmisto:
- Vaihe 2: Käytetty komponentti:
- Vaihe 3: Piirikaavio
- Vaihe 4: Koodi ja video
Video: Näppäimistönumeroiden näyttäminen 16 x 2 nestekidenäytössä 8051: 4 -vaiheilla
2024 Kirjoittaja: John Day | [email protected]. Viimeksi muokattu: 2024-01-30 09:03
Tässä projektissa aiomme liittää näppäimistön ja LCD: n 8051: een. Kun painamme näppäimistön näppäintä, saamme lcd: n vastausnumeron
Vaihe 1: Käytetty ohjelmisto:
Koska näytämme proteus -simulaatiota, TÄMÄN KOODAAMISEKSI JA SIMULOINNILLE TARVITSIT:
1 Keil -visio: Heillä on paljon tuotteita keilistä. joten tarvitset c51 -kääntäjän. Voit ladata ohjelmiston täältä
2 Proteus -ohjelmisto simulointia varten: Tämä on ohjelmisto, joka näyttää simulaation. Saat paljon tietoa tämän ohjelmiston lataamisesta.
Jos teet sen laitteistossa, tarvitset koodin lataamiseen laitteistoon yhden flash -taika -ohjelmiston. Muista, että flash -magiaa on kehittänyt nxp. Joten et voi ladata kaikkia 8051 -perheen mikrokontrollereita tämän ohjelmiston kautta. Joten vain Philips -pohjainen ohjain voit ladata.
Vaihe 2: Käytetty komponentti:
Tässä esittelyvideossamme käytämme proteus -simulaatiota, mutta jos teet sen laitteistossasi, tarvitset varmasti nämä komponentit tähän projektiin:
8051 Kehityskortti: Joten jos sinulla on tämä levy, se on parempi, jotta voit ladata koodin helposti itse.
LCD 16*2: Tämä on 16*2 LCD. Tässä nestekidenäytössä on 16 nastaa.
4*3 Näppäimistömatriisi: Tässä käytämme 4*3 näppäimistömatriisia. Joten voit käyttää 4*3 -matriisia tai mitä tahansa muuta matriisia, kuten 4*4, ei hätää. Sitä varten meidän on lisättävä koodi USB -UART -muuntimeen: Tämä on 9 -nastainen D -tyypin urosliitin RS232 O/p: lle
Jotkut hyppyjohdot
Vaihe 3: Piirikaavio
Vaihe 4: Koodi ja video
Koko projektikuvaus on esitetty yllä olevassa videossa
Lähdekoodin saat GitHub -linkistämme
Jos sinulla on epäilyksiä tästä projektista, voit vapaasti kommentoida meitä alla. Ja jos haluat oppia lisää sulautetusta järjestelmästä, voit käydä YouTube -kanavallamme
Käy ja tykkää Facebook -sivustamme saadaksesi usein päivityksiä.
Kiitos ja terveiset,
Suositeltava:
8051 Liitäntä DS1307 RTC: hen ja aikaleiman näyttäminen nestekidenäytössä: 5 vaihetta
8051 -liitäntä DS1307 RTC: n kanssa ja aikaleiman näyttäminen nestekidenäytössä: Tässä opetusohjelmassa olemme selittäneet, kuinka voimme liittää 8051 -mikrokontrollerin ds1307 RTC: hen. Tässä näytämme RTC -ajan lcd: ssä käyttämällä proteus -simulaatiota
Sykkeen näyttäminen STONE -nestekidenäytössä Ar: 31 askelta
Sykkeen näyttäminen STONE -nestekidenäytössä Ar: lyhyt johdanto Joitakin aikoja sitten löysin verkkokaupasta sykesensorimoduulin MAX30100. Tämä moduuli voi kerätä käyttäjien veren happea ja syketietoja, mikä on myös yksinkertaista ja kätevää käyttää. Tietojen mukaan huomasin, että
Syke STONE -nestekidenäytössä: 7 vaihetta
Syke STONE -nestekidenäytössä: Löysin jokin aika sitten verkkokaupasta sykesensorimoduulin MAX30100. Tämä moduuli voi kerätä käyttäjien veren happi- ja syketietoja, mikä on myös yksinkertaista ja kätevää käyttää. Tietojen mukaan huomasin, että on olemassa kirjastoja M
Näppäimistön käyttöliittymä 8051: llä ja näppäimistönumeroiden näyttäminen 7 segmentissä: 4 vaihetta (kuvien kanssa)
Näppäimistön käyttöliittymä 8051: llä ja näppäimistön numeroiden näyttäminen 7 segmentissä: Tässä opetusohjelmassa kerron sinulle, kuinka voimme liittää näppäimistön 8051: llä ja näyttää näppäimistön numerot 7 segmentin näytössä
Mukautetun merkin tulostaminen nestekidenäytössä 8051 -mikrokontrollerilla: 4 vaihetta
Mukautetun merkin tulostaminen nestekidenäytössä 8051 -mikrokontrollerilla: Tässä projektissa kerromme sinulle, kuinka tulostaa mukautettuja merkkejä 16 * 2 -nestekidenäytöllä 8051 -mikrokontrollerilla. Käytämme nestekidenäyttöä 8 -bittisessä tilassa. Voimme tehdä saman myös 4 -bittisessä tilassa